    Beosystem AV 9000 Problem - at least I could get the model correct - sorry!

    I try again. When I try to start up the Beosystem AV 9000, I get the following error message:

    SW.1.10 error 1

    on the lower display panel next to the video.

    Can anyone please help?

    your tv is not broken, i had the same problem with my AV9000
     

    the masterlink cable is in the wrong socket...

    error 1 indicates a communication problem betweeen the monitor and the base unit - probably the short masterlink cable....
